Output e4cda38abcfa9945f995655ce95504c898130b62ad7671f443b406ae0668a182:2

value
5915174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6696dea79872056fa39e966a2f883781551f9521 OP_EQUAL
address
3B3Taix7uA99TbGVEbiPFtq8fASg17ohg6
transaction
e4cda38abcfa9945f995655ce95504c898130b62ad7671f443b406ae0668a182